NURSE 3470
Mental Health Nursing
University of Missouri-Columbia ·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
Students will discover behavioral, social, interpersonal, neurobiological, and neuropsychological aspects of mental health nursing. Therapeutic use of self in designing and implementing nursing care for clients throughout the life cycle is emphasized. Content on psychopathology is included. This course includes didactic and clinical elements. Graded on A-F basis only. Credit Hour s : 4 Prerequisites: NURSE 3300 and NURSE 3400
